gpt4 book ai didi

ios - iO 上 phonegap 的唯一标识符

转载 作者:可可西里 更新时间:2023-11-01 05:36:08 26 4
gpt4 key购买 nike

我需要在 phonegap 应用程序中识别用户。

在文档中我找到了 device.uuid ( http://docs.phonegap.com/en/2.0.0/cordova_device_device.md.html#device.uuid ),但它仅适用于 Android。在 iOs 上它已被弃用:https://developer.apple.com/news/index.php?id=3212013a#top .

我在 native iOs 代码中看到了一些解决方案,它们获取设备的 MAC 地址,但我需要 phonegap 解决方案。

谢谢!

最佳答案

现在 device.uuid 在 iOS 上返回 identifierForVendor,因此不再需要我的插件。

旧答案:您仍然可以使用 device.uuid,但它不是真正的 UUID

来自 phonegap 文档

iOS Quirk

The uuid on iOS is not unique to a device, but varies for each application, for each installation. It changes if you delete and re-install the app, and possibly also when you upgrade iOS, or even upgrade your app per version (apparent in iOS 5.1). The uuid is not a reliable value.

我有一个 MAC address phonegap plugin , 但我听说你无法在 iOS 7 上获取 MAC 地址

我的插件不再工作,无法在 iOS 7 上获取 MAC 地址

编辑:顺便说一句,我为供应商插件创建了一个标识符 https://github.com/jcesarmobile/IDFVPlugin

有了这个插件你可以得到 iOS identifier for vendor

关于ios - iO 上 phonegap 的唯一标识符,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18250460/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com